Windows系统下Shadowsocks使用教程

什么是Shadowsocks

Shadowsocks是一种流行的开源代理工具,通常用于科学上网。它利用了SOCKS5代理协议,能够有效地隐藏用户的真实IP地址,帮助用户突破网络封锁。Windows用户可以通过Shadowsocks实现安全的网络访问。

安装Shadowsocks

下载Shadowsocks

首先,我们需要下载Shadowsocks的Windows客户端。可以前往Shadowsocks的GitHub页面下载最新版本。请确保选择合适的版本(32位或64位)以适配您的系统。

安装Shadowsocks

  1. 解压缩下载的文件:下载完成后,将其解压缩到您希望安装的文件夹中。
  2. 运行Shadowsocks:找到解压后的文件夹,双击运行Shadowsocks.exe
  3. 首次运行设置:在第一次运行时,您需要配置Shadowsocks的服务器信息。

配置Shadowsocks

添加服务器信息

  1. 打开Shadowsocks客户端:运行Shadowsocks后,您会看到客户端界面。
  2. 右键点击系统托盘图标:在系统托盘中找到Shadowsocks图标,右键点击并选择“服务器设置”。
  3. 添加新服务器:在服务器设置窗口中,点击“添加”按钮。
    • 服务器地址:输入您购买的Shadowsocks服务器的IP地址。
    • 服务器端口:输入对应的端口号。
    • 密码:输入用于连接的密码。
    • 加密方法:选择适合的加密方法(如aes-256-gcm)。
  4. 保存设置:完成以上步骤后,点击“确定”保存服务器设置。

设置代理规则

为了让Shadowsocks更有效地工作,您可能需要设置代理规则。右键点击托盘图标,选择“全局模式”、“绕过局域网”或“自动模式”,具体取决于您的使用需求。

使用Shadowsocks

连接到服务器

  1. 选择服务器:右键点击Shadowsocks托盘图标,选择您刚刚添加的服务器。
  2. 连接:选择“连接”,客户端将尝试连接到您选择的服务器。如果连接成功,您会看到托盘图标变成绿色。
  3. 验证连接:您可以通过访问被墙的网站来测试您的连接是否成功。

测试Shadowsocks的速度

使用Shadowsocks后,您可以通过网络速度测试工具(如Speedtest.net)来评估您的连接速度。这有助于判断您的服务器是否需要更换。

常见问题解答

1. 如何解决Shadowsocks无法连接的问题?

  • 检查服务器信息:确保您输入的服务器地址、端口、密码和加密方法正确无误。
  • 更换网络:尝试切换到其他网络,可能是网络环境导致的问题。
  • 检查防火墙设置:有时,Windows防火墙可能会阻止Shadowsocks的连接,确保将其添加到例外列表中。

2. 如何提高Shadowsocks的速度?

  • 更换服务器:如果当前服务器速度慢,可以尝试更换其他服务器。
  • 使用更快的协议:某些加密方式可能会导致速度变慢,可以尝试更换为更轻量的加密方法。

3. Shadowsocks安全吗?

Shadowsocks本身是一种加密代理,能够隐藏您的真实IP地址,提高网络安全性。然而,用户仍需注意不要在不安全的网站上输入个人信息。

4. Shadowsocks能访问哪些网站?

通过Shadowsocks,您可以访问被墙的网站,如Google、YouTube、Facebook等。在连接后,您可以正常浏览这些网站。

结论

通过本文的详细教程,您已经掌握了如何在Windows系统中安装和使用Shadowsocks的基本操作。在使用过程中,请确保遵循相关法律法规,安全上网。希望您能享受更加自由、安全的网络体验!

正文完